WebJun 17, 2024 · Plasmid Ca-FLARE (TF) from Dr. Alice Ting's lab contains the insert NRX-TM-Nav1.6 -CaMbp(M2)-eLOV-TEVcs(ENLYFQ M)-tTA-VP16 and is published in Nat Biotechnol. 2024 Jun 26. doi: … Alice Ting was born in Taiwan and immigrated to the United States when she was three years old. She was raised in Texas and attended the Texas Academy of Mathematics and Science (TAMS). She received her B.S. in Chemistry from Harvard University in 1996, working with Nobel laureate E.J. Corey. She completed her Ph.D. with Peter G. Schultz at the University of California, Berkeley in 2000.

WebNov 2, 2024 · Here we report a molecular technology for stable genetic tagging of cells that exhibit activity-related increases in intracellular calcium concentration (FLiCRE). We used FLiCRE to transcriptionally label activated neural ensembles in the nucleus accumbens of the mouse brain during brief stimulation of aversive inputs.
